E3 2011 Awards: Best Nintendo 3DS Game

We've done the awards for one of the new handheld systems, the PlayStation Vita, so now it's time to move on to the other, the Nintendo 3DS. Despite the platform just releasing, Nintendo were quite coy on new titles and many of the other publishers didn't show off that much either - rather surprising considering the need for momentum right now.
The GamingUnion.net E3 2011 Awards were decided by the five members that attended the show. Each person voted for their first, second and third pick and the votes were then tallied up. Therefore, it's a decision felt by the majority and not an individual.
Best Nintendo 3DS Game: Super Mario 3DS
We all knew it was coming, but that didn't stop Super Mario 3DS from reminding us exactly why Mario has been so strong over the years. With plenty of new mechanics finding their way into the title, it's hard not to see Super Mario 3DS being a massive title for Nintendo this year.
